
A flight from Los Angeles International Airport (LAX) to Iran is a journey that spans over 7,000 miles and typically involves a layover in a major international hub such as London, Paris, or Frankfurt. The total travel time can range from 15 to 20 hours, depending on the specific routing and airline. Despite the distance and travel time, flights from LAX to Iran are in high demand due to the strong cultural and economic ties between the two regions.
There are several major airlines that offer flights from LAX to Iran, including Iran Air, Lufthansa, and Turkish Airlines. Ticket prices can vary significantly depending on the time of year, airline, and availability. However, on average, a round-trip ticket from LAX to Iran can cost anywhere from $1,000 to $2,000.

Tehran, the vibrant capital of Iran, is a bustling metropolis with a diverse range of cultural and historical sites, including museums, palaces, and religious landmarks. Persepolis, an ancient city founded by Darius the Great, boasts magnificent ruins that showcase the architectural prowess of the Achaemenid Empire. The Caspian Sea coast, with its picturesque beaches and stunning natural beauty, provides a tranquil escape from the urban landscapes.

The connection between “Tourism: Ancient ruins, modern cities, natural beauty” and “lax to iran flight” lies in the diverse range of tourism opportunities that Iran offers to travelers.
- Ancient Ruins: Iran is home to some of the world’s most impressive ancient ruins, including Persepolis, a UNESCO World Heritage Site that dates back to the Achaemenid Empire. Travelers can explore these ruins and learn about Iran’s rich history and culture.
- Modern Cities: Iran’s modern cities, such as Tehran and Isfahan, offer a vibrant blend of traditional and modern architecture. Travelers can visit museums, art galleries, and shopping malls, and experience the bustling atmosphere of these urban centers.
- Natural Beauty: Iran is also home to a variety of natural beauty, including the Caspian Sea coast, the Alborz Mountains, and the Lut Desert. Travelers can enjoy hiking, skiing, swimming, and other outdoor activities in these stunning natural surroundings.
The combination of ancient ruins, modern cities, and natural beauty makes Iran a compelling destination for tourists from all over the world. “lax to iran flight” provides travelers with the opportunity to experience the rich cultural heritage, vibrant urban centers, and stunning natural beauty that Iran has to offer.
